Iron ore extraction in India yields lumps to fines in the ratio of 2:3 — 60% of the ore generation is in the form of iron ore fines. For efficient utilization, it is imperative to process these fines. The push towards the beneficiation of low-grade iron ore could reshape trade patterns if effectively implemented.

The first commercial production of phosphate rock began in England in 1847. A wide variety of techniques and equipment is used to mine and process phosphate rocks in order to beneficiate low-grade ores and remove impurities. Falling prices for iron ore with lower quality than 60 % Fe have led increasingly to the design of iron ore beneficiation lines. General problems of water scarcity and risks with tailings dams have led to the focus shifting to dry beneficiation technologies.
